Chapter 2 Judith Butler’s Gender Performativity

2.1 Sources of Gender Performativity

2.1.1 Austin’s Speech Act Theory

In John Langshaw Austin’s famous pragmatic work How to Do Things withWords,he assumes that in addition to describing and narrating things,words can bealso the performativity of things.He often takes some examples.

‘I do(this woman to be my lawful wedded wife)’as uttered in the course of themarriage ceremony.’

‘I name this ship the Queen Elizabeth’as uttered when smashing the bottleagainst the stem.’

‘I bet you sixpence it will rain tomorrow’

Obviously,Austin considers that these examples are“not to describe my doingof what I should be said in so uttering to be doing or to state that I am doing it:it is todo it”.(Austin,1975)But Austin considers that performatives do not always functionin contexts.He differentiates two performatives utterances,the“serious utterance”and the“unserious utterance”.The basis of his distinction is whether performative utterances are in the proper context and obtain the authority to act,so as to furtherproduce the effect.“There must exist an accepted conventional procedure having acertain conventional effect,that procedure to include the uttering of certain words bycertain persons in certain circumstances,and further,the particular persons andcircumstances in a given case must be appropriate for the invocation of the particularprocedure invoked.”(Austin,1975)

2.2 Essentialism and Constructivism

Essentialism proposes that biology is destiny.They convince that women,as anatural category,own some special and proprietary features that men do not have,inthe meantime,these features are everlasting,universal and changeless on the domainof time and culture.
